Marshall Emberton III And Willen II Are Here To Redefine Portable Speakers

Marshall Emberton III and Willen II Portable Speakers

Looking to update your on-the-go entertainment setup? If so, you may want to hold out till August 26 because Marshall, the brand best known for its guitar amps, is launching not one but two portable speakers. The two new upcoming portable speakers and Emberton III and Willen II.

Emberton III

Tipped to have more bass than its predecessor, this newest iteration of the Emberton first launched in 2021 features Dynamic Loudness that adjusts the tonal balance as you change the volume, to deliver a rich and full sound. The Emberton III further features a Marshall-exclusive True Stereophonic that produces multidirectional sound for immersive 360° audio enjoyment.

The speaker produces stereo sound through a 2 10 W full-range driver, and 2 passive radiators—backed by 2x 38 W Class D amplifier, while Bluetooth 5.3 LE enables up to 100-meter (330 feet) free field range. Speaking of Bluetooth, it is Bluetooth LE Audio-ready which is a “future-proof tech” that will open up a new world of audio-sharing possibilities with Auracast.

The speaker inherits the Marshall’s iconic design language, boasting a rugged exterior with a guitar amp inspired grilled, and it is IP67 rated for dust- and waterproof allowing it up to 1 meter (3 feet) submersion in water for up to 30 minutes. Like any good Bluetooth speaker, it comes with a built-in microphone for hands-free talking and it is outfitted with a rechargeable battery good for over 32 hours of playtime.

Willen II

The Willen II, Marshall’s smallest portable speaker, may be small but it packs a punch. Marshall said the larger frame on the next-gen Willen enhances bass performance, while improved drivers deliver balanced audio. With an IP67 rating, the speaker is both dustproof and waterproof, capable of being submerged up to 1 meter (3 feet) for 30 minutes.

It offers over 17 hours of playtime and features a rubber strap for easy attachment anywhere. The built-in microphone supports hands-free calls, and it’s also Bluetooth LE Audio-ready, ready to usher in the new era of audio sharing through Auracast.

Equipped with a 2” 10 W full-range driver, two passive radiators, and a 38W Class D amplifier, the Willen II is truly small but mighty.

Pricing and Availability

The new Marshall Emberton III and Willen II Portable Speakers are available for pre-order in a choice of black and brass, and cream, for US$169.99 and US$119.99, respectively.
